Biography

John[1] was born in 1804. He was the son of James Fairbairn and Isobel Tait at Westmoriston.[2] He passed away in 1876.

Baptized 17 Jul 1804 Legerwood, Berwickshire, Scotland[3][2]

Died 28 Jul 1876 85 Leith Walk, South Leith, Midlothian, Scotland

cert. shows John as a 72 yr old flour miller (formerly), married to Helen Martin, died 3:30am (certified); S/o James Fairbairn, farmer and Helen (sic) Tait, both deceased. Informant: son A M Fairbairn of 18 Fairfield Pl, Aberdeen, reg 31st July[4]
